Abstract
The description relates to a smart ring. In one example, the smart ring can be configured to be worn on a first segment of a finger of a user. The example smart ring can include at least one flexion sensor secured to the smart ring in a manner that can detect a distance between the at least one flexion sensor and a second segment of the finger. The example smart ring can also include an input component configured to analyze signals from the at least one flexion sensor to detect a pose of the finger.

9. A system, comprising:
-
a smart ring configured to be worn on a finger of a user; a rotation sensor secured to the smart ring, the rotation sensor configured to sense rotation of the finger; a flexion sensor secured to the smart ring, the flexion sensor configured to sense flexion of the finger; and
,a processor and storage storing computer-readable instructions which, when executed by the processor, cause the processor to map signals from the rotation sensor and the flexion sensor to a coordinate system of the smart ring. - View Dependent Claims (10, 11, 12, 13, 14)

15. A computer-implemented method, comprising:
-
obtaining rotation signals from a smart ring worn on a finger of a user, the rotation signals reflecting rotation of the finger relative to a hand of the user; obtaining flexion signals reflecting flexion of the finger; and
,mapping the rotation signals and the flexion signals to a coordinate system of the smart ring. - View Dependent Claims (16, 17, 18, 19, 20)
